Structured settlements?


in 2003, my daughter had a case settled for malpractice. i recieved documents shortly after about her structured settlement acct. since then i had a fire as a result i no longer have those documents.I just recently i recieved notice from the structured settlement specialist requesting my daughters social security number and he also indicated to me that my daughters acct has not been fully set up due to a lack of info that her attorney failed to provide. i tried to reach the attorney but was told that his liscence has been suspended during 2003. my daughter is approaching the age to recieve her money, my question is what do i have to do for her to recieve it. who should i contact since the attorney who handled the case is not reachable, and the settlement specialist is not much assistance either????--- please help

If your daughter was a minor child when the settlement was reached then the court would have had to approve it and a guardian ad litem would have been appointed by the court.

Go to the court clerk's office, look up the file and get the documents you need.

The insurance company who handles the "structured" settlement would have all of the information as well.

Get the court records.

Suggest you contact your local bar association. If the lawyer had his license suspended all his files would have been taken over by the bar associations (that is the professional organization of lawyers) They would have your daughter's
file and be able to get the information to you. Check the
internet for bar associaton of whatever state or province your lawyer practiced in and contact them. Good luck!
